What Is Semantic SEO?

Semantic SEO is the process of optimizing content around topics, concepts, and intent instead of relying only on exact-match keywords. The goal is to help search engines understand the meaning behind content and how different ideas relate to each other.

Rather than creating isolated pages for slight keyword variations, semantic SEO focuses on building depth around a topic. This allows content to rank for a wider range of related searches while improving overall relevance.

A semantic SEO approach typically includes:

  • topic clustering and connected content
  • contextual keyword usage and related terms
  • internal linking between semantically related pages
  • structured content aligned with intent
  • entity-based optimization

This shift reflects how modern search engines interpret language. Google no longer evaluates pages only through keyword density, but through contextual understanding and topical relationships.


What Is Semantic Search SEO?

Semantic search SEO refers to optimizing content for how search engines interpret intent and context rather than just literal wording. Search engines now analyze relationships between words, entities, and user behavior to determine the most relevant results.

For example, Google understands that terms such as:

  • running shoes
  • athletic footwear
  • trainers

may refer to the same broader intent depending on context. Because of this, modern optimization requires broader topical coverage instead of repetitive keyword targeting.

Semantic search also evaluates how comprehensively a page addresses a topic. Pages that cover related subtopics, questions, and contextual concepts are more likely to perform well in AI-driven search environments.


What Is the Difference Between Semantic SEO and Traditional SEO?

Traditional SEO focused heavily on exact-match keywords and individual page optimization. Semantic SEO expands beyond that approach by prioritizing meaning, relationships, and topical authority.

Traditional SEO often emphasized:

  • exact keyword repetition
  • isolated landing pages
  • one-page-per-keyword strategies
  • narrow optimization tactics

Semantic SEO focuses more on:

  • search intent and contextual relevance
  • topic clustering and relationships
  • entity optimization
  • comprehensive coverage of subjects

This does not mean traditional SEO principles are obsolete. Technical SEO, keyword research, and on-page optimization still matter. However, semantic SEO connects these elements into a broader framework that aligns better with how modern search engines process information.

Topic Clusters and Topical Authority

One of the most important aspects of semantic SEO is topical authority. Instead of ranking individual pages in isolation, search engines increasingly evaluate how comprehensively a site covers a subject.

This is typically achieved through topic clusters, where:

  • a pillar page targets a broad topic
  • supporting pages address related subtopics
  • internal links connect all related content

For example, a site targeting semantic SEO might also create related content around:

  • structured data
  • AI search optimization
  • content architecture
  • entity SEO
  • topical mapping

This structure helps search engines understand depth and expertise. It also improves user navigation, since readers can explore connected topics naturally across the site.


Structured Data and Entity Optimization

Structured data helps search engines interpret content more accurately by providing machine-readable context. This makes it easier for search systems to identify entities such as products, organizations, reviews, and authors.

Common uses of structured data include:

  • article schema
  • FAQ schema
  • product schema
  • review schema
  • organization schema

Entity optimization works alongside structured data by reinforcing relationships between concepts. Instead of relying only on keywords, semantic SEO focuses on building contextual relevance around entities and their associations.

This becomes increasingly important in AI-driven search environments, where systems prioritize understanding over simple matching.

What Is a Semantic SEO Example?

A semantic SEO example would be a website creating a comprehensive content cluster around “running shoes” rather than publishing separate pages optimized only for slight keyword variations.

Instead of repeating the same term excessively, the content would naturally include related concepts such as:

  • athletic footwear
  • marathon training shoes
  • cushioning and support
  • trail running sneakers

The content would also connect related pages through internal linking and contextual structure. This helps search engines understand the broader topic and improves the likelihood of ranking for multiple related queries.
